A Director’s contribution should also extend beyond the confines of the formal environment of such meetings, through the sharing of views, advice, experience and strategic networks which would further the interests of the Company. The Directors, whether individually or collectively, also engage with Management, heads of the Group’s business units and departments and the Group’s external consultants in order to better understand the challenges faced by the Group and the input of the Directors, through such engagements, provide invaluable perspective to Management. Directors’ Multiple Board Representations and Time Commitments (Provision 1.5) When proposing the re-election of Directors, the NRC also considers the competing time commitments faced by Directors with multiple listed company board representations and/or other principal commitments. An analysis of the directorships (which includes directorships by groups and executive appointments) held by the Directors is reviewed annually by the NRC. Each Director is also required to confirm annually to the NRC as to whether he/she has any issue with competing time commitments which may impact his/her ability to provide sufficient time and attention to his/her duties as a Director of the Company. Based on the analysis, the Directors’ annual confirmation and the Directors’ commitments and contributions to the Company, which are also evident in their level of attendance and participation at Committee and NEDs IDs’ meetings, the NRC is satisfied that all Directors are able to carry out and have been adequately carrying out their duties as a Director of the Company. The Board noted that including the directorship held in the Company, the number of listed company board representations currently held by each of the Directors ranged from one to three in number (including the Company) and those held by Mr Kwek Leng Beng are on the boards of the related companies of the Company.
